How much is a round-trip flight from Cleveland to Wyoming?

What is the cheapest month to fly from Cleveland to Wyoming?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Cleveland to Wyoming,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Cleveland to Wyoming is April, when tickets cost $456 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and March,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$688 and $613 respectively.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Cleveland to Wyoming?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Cleveland to Wyoming cl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

When flying from Cleveland to Wyoming, you should consider leaving on a Sunday and avoid Saturdays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Cleveland, you’ll find the best rates on Fridays and the most expensive ones on Mondays.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Cleveland to Wyoming?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Cleveland to Wyoming,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Cleveland to Wyoming,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 20 weeks before departure.
